Does rotational acetabular osteotomy affect subsequent total hip arthroplasty?
Kiyokazu Fukui1, Ayumi Kaneuji, Tanzo Sugimori
1Department of Orthopaedic Surgery, Kanazawa Medical University, 1-1 Daigaku, Uchinada-machi, Kahokugun, Ishikawa, 920-0293, Japan, 66406kf@kanazawa-med.ac.jp.
Previous rotational acetabular osteotomy (RAO) does not negatively impact outcomes for total hip arthroplasty (THA) in patients with developmental dysplasia of the hip (DDH). Midterm results show similar revision rates and functional scores for THA after RAO compared to primary THA.

Background:
- Developmental dysplasia of the hip (DDH) can lead to osteoarthritis, sometimes requiring total hip arthroplasty (THA).
- Rotational acetabular osteotomy (RAO) is a surgical procedure used to treat DDH.
- The long-term effects of prior RAO on subsequent THA outcomes are not fully understood.
Purpose of the Study:
- To evaluate the impact of previous RAO on the outcomes of THA in patients with DDH-related osteoarthritis.
- To compare THA outcomes in patients with a history of RAO versus those undergoing primary THA.
Main Methods:
- A retrospective study comparing 22 hips that underwent THA after RAO (group R) with 30 hips that underwent primary THA (group C).
- Outcomes were assessed at an average follow-up of 8.2 years (range 7-11 years).
- Key outcome measures included component loosening, revision rates, Harris hip scores (HHSs), operative time, blood loss, and wear rates.
Main Results:
- Both groups demonstrated similar midterm outcomes with no component loosening or revisions.
- Harris hip scores (HHSs) were not compromised by prior RAO.
- No significant differences were observed in operative time, blood loss, or component wear rates between the groups.
- No major complications such as infection, dislocation, or fracture occurred in either group.
Conclusions:
- Rotational acetabular osteotomy (RAO) does not adversely affect midterm outcomes of total hip arthroplasty (THA) for developmental dysplasia of the hip (DDH).
- Prior RAO does not increase revision rates, compromise functional scores (HHSs), or shorten the survivorship of subsequent THA.
- These findings support RAO as a viable option for managing DDH before eventual THA.
